Engineered by Cesaroni Technology, the 55F29-12A is a 29mm solid rocket motor designed for model rocketry. As an official F-class motor, it delivers a total impulse of 54.8 Ns over a 1.90 second burn window.

With an average thrust of 28.9 N and a peak of 36.0 N, it features a neutral thrust curve optimal for general sport flying. It utilizes the Imax propellant formulation, dictating its specific impulse and exhaust signature.
